Microsoft SharePoint Information Disclosure Vulnerability - CVE-2020-16941ID: oval:org.secpod.oval:def:66038 | Date: (C)2020-10-14 (M)2024-01-08 |
Class: VULNERABILITY | Family: windows |
An information disclosure vulnerability exists when Microsoft SharePoint Server improperly discloses its folder structure when rendering specific web pages. An attacker who took advantage of this information disclosure could view the folder path of scripts loaded on the page. To take advantage of the vulnerability, an attacker would require access to the specific SharePoint page affected by this vulnerability. The security update addresses the vulnerability by correcting how scripts are referenced on some SharePoint pages.
